Maxivision Eye Hospital, a prominent eye care provider in India, has expanded its facilities in their Somajiguda branch, with an investment of Rs 4 crore. Over all, the company has so far invested Rs 20 crore on this 18,000-sq-ft super tertiary eye care centre, which was opened in 2010 with an extent of 10,000-sq-ft.

As the facility grew in popularity, Maxivision also got accredited with the Telangana government's most prestigious eye care programmes, Arogyasree and Udyogsree. The number of patients who come to this scheme is growing every month, and Maxivision has expanded to another 10,000 square ft in the same building to create a dedicated floor for EHS and Arogyasree patients. This dedicated floor can now treat more than 1,000 people every month, without any compromise on service and quality output.

The eye care and surgical technology exclusive for this floor will be at par with any super specialty eye care hospital in the town. A dedicated team of doctors and optometrists will manage this floor and patients. This EHS floor also features three dedicated EHS Consultant rooms, a specialised EHS ward with 20 beds to the pre-operative and post-operative care needs of patients, and an EHS OT complex tailored to meet the unique requirements of EHS patients.

The hospital has already established its excellence with a total of five modern operating theaters, equipped with state-of-the-art infection control technology, dedicated to performing a wide range of eye surgeries, including cataract, retina, cornea, glaucoma, oculoplasty, and squint surgeries.

Currently, the hospital boasts a healthcare facility comprising 20 dedicated bed wards, four specialized rooms, and private accommodations to cater to patients' varying needs. It accommodates and provides expert care to approximately 200 patients daily, facilitating over 500 surgeries per month.

The operation theaters (OTs) at this branch are equipped with HEPA filters and AHU units, ensuring a sterile and hygienic surgical environment. The hospital features five specialized theaters: one exclusively designated for retina surgeries, three for cataract surgeries, and a dedicated theater for FEMTO-cataract surgeries.

Notably, the Somajiguda branch is equipped with cutting-edge medical technology, including stellaris phaco machines, centurion phaco machine, catalys femto cataract machine, and constellation VR machine, complemented by high-end anesthesia workstations.

Recently, Maxivision got an investment from Asia’s largest Health care investor, Quadria Capital, from Singapore. The funds of Rs 1,400 crore will be used for expanding its network from 40 hospitals to 100 by the end of this year, and also create and enhance world-class facilities in current hospitals.
